| About the font: |
| |
| Unlike most LED/LCD style fonts mine could be recreated with an |
| actual LED. I created this font working from memories of the good |
| old Speak and Spell display. Since I don't have an actual Speak |
| and Spell to work from I had to just do as well as I could in its |
| spirit. Be warned that some characters look just like others. The |
| ( and the <, for instance. Also C and [. Most of these will be |
| pretty clear in context. To see all the sections of the LED "lit |
| up" at once use character 127 (hold down alt and type 0127 on the |
| numeric keypad). This font is, of course, monospaced. |
